Employment opportunities for interior design professionals are plentiful in India. Graduates from interior design courses can find gainful employment with independent architects or in large architectural firms, building contractors, hotels and resorts. Professionals may also find work in private design consultancy firms, theaters and exhibition organizing companies. The public sector also has a large demand for interior designers. Public institutions such as town planning bureaus, metropolitan and regional development departments and the public works department have a need for the expertise of interior designers. There are three different regulating bodies for the three most sought after professions mentioned by you:
For CA it is the ICAI, for CS it is ICSI and for CWA there is ICWAI.
These are the professional programs developed in a way that carries out the proficiency through qualifying one level after the other.
To gain the admissions to either of the three, you need to apply / register through there websites as there is a facility of online registration.
